NOTICE OF FILING DATES FOR CITY OF DETROIT LAKES ELECTED OFFICERS
Any eligible person desirous of having his or her name placed on the official ballot as a candidate shall file an affidavit with the City Clerk at 1025 Roosevelt Avenue and pay a fee of $5.00.
Filings for City Office
OPEN at 8:00 A.M. Tuesday, July 14, 2026
CLOSE at 5:00 P.M. Tuesday, July 28, 2026
OFFICERS TO BE ELECTED ARE AS FOLLOWS:
| Council Member (First Ward) |
One (1) | Four-Year Term |
| Council Member (Second Ward) |
One (1) | Four-Year Term |
| Council Member (Third Ward) |
One (1) |
Four-Year Term |
| Alderman At Large | Two (2) | Four-Year Term |
City Election will be on TUESDAY, NOVEMBER 3, 2026
Terms of elected officials begin first Tuesday in January, 2027
Primary Elections How to Vote
Vote Early by Mail
Early voting will begin on Friday, June 26 and go through Monday, August 10. To apply for an absentee ballot, visit the website of the Minnesota Secretary of State.
Your ballot must be received in the mail by Election Day. You can return your ballot in person at the Becker County Courthouse no later than 8 p.m. on Election Day to count.
Vote Early in Person
Early in-person voting begins on Friday, 26 and go through Monday, August 10. To vote early in person, apply for an absentee ballot and return your ballot in person no later than 8 p.m. on Election Day.
Detroit Lakes residents can vote early in person at the Becker County Courthouse
Vote on Election Day
Election Day is on Tuesday, August 11. All Detroit Lakes residents can vote from 7:00am to 8:00pm at their voting location.
